About Deva Rangarajan
Deva Rangarajan is a scholar working on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management, Sociology and Political Science, Strategy and Management, Information Systems and Management and Marketing, having authored 37 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Customer Service Quality and Loyalty (18 papers), Digital Marketing and Social Media (12 papers), Technology Adoption and User Behaviour (8 papers),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(6 papers), Supply Chain Resilience and Risk Management (5 papers), Service and Product Innovation (5 papers), Ethics in Business and Education (4 papers) and Quality and Supply Management (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management (664 citations), Information Systems and Management (357 citations), Marketing (472 citations), Strategy and Management (276 citations) and Management Information Systems (142 citations). Deva Rangarajan has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Paul Gemmel, Katrien Verleye, Steve Muylle, Arun Sharma, Bert Paesbrugghe, Niels Schillewaert, Kristof De Wulf, Betsy D. Gelb, Eli Jones and Wynne W. Chin. Their work appears in journals such as Industrial Marketing Management, Journal of Personal Selling and Sales Management, Journal of Business and Industrial Marketing, California Management Review and Business Horizons.
